2 AIAG VDA Alignment

The new standard for FMEAs is released

As of recently, the new standard can be obtained through the AIAG in English and the VDA in German.

Take your time to familiarize with the new rules. The new standard does not require revising FMEAs in

progress or existing FMEAs. Moderators and auditors are not trained yet. Please keep in mind that time is

needed to prepare trainings in order to train users in the new methods.

For a first orientation PLATO already provides two new form sheets in e1ns.methods:

• DFMEA AIAG/VDA

• PFMEA AIAG/VDA

The structure analysis (higher level, focus element, lower level) is displayed in the head area. The form

sheet shows function and failure analysis, risk analysis, optimization and subsequently also the MSR

analysis.

In each case the focus element will be edited. Depending data from other levels will be displayed.

The form sheets will gradually be developed and the provision of further functional enhancements is

intended in the future. The concept of PLATO e1ns is based on plug in technology. This allows developing

updates for form sheets at any time and delivering them independent of software releases.

4.6 Monitoring and system response (MSR)

When using a product it is important that a user can detect and respond to problems during the use or

product defects, respectively. Or that the product reacts autonomously in case of a defect and, for

example, switches into an emergency mode. An MSR analysis considers these aspects.

Monitoring and system response extends a design FMEA by analyzing the effectivity of monitoring and

describing the appropriate system response. Potential failures that occur during customer operation and

their effects can be taken into account. The original effect can be mitigated or even prevented.

A new focus view <MSR> is now available for assigning functions for failure detection (monitoring) and

failure management (system response). This focus view is activated by default. For a connection between

function and failure the types (M)onitoring and (R)esponse are available.

The results of the MSR analysis will automatically be applied when using the form sheet FMEA MSR for

VDA/AIAG harmonization.

Procedure:

• Activate the focus view <MSR>.

The drop-down menus appear in the matrix.

• Choose a function in the tree that you want to link with a failure.

• Select (M)onitoring or (R)esponse in the corresponding drop-down menus.

In the example a control unit detects whether voltage is applied to the lighting or current flows to

power the lighting system of the bicycle in order to detect a lack of visibility during the night. If the

lighting fails the system will switch to the emergency battery. This ensures that the failure does not

occur and the driver is seen.

The failure net shows the MSR functions that disrupt the failure net and hence block the occurrence of the

undesirable failure effects.

Page 13: PLATO e1ns 3.0 / SCIO™ 8 · 2019. 8. 7. · • PFMEA AIAG/VDA The structure analysis (higher level, focus element, lower level) is displayed in the head area. The form sheet shows

PLATO e1ns 3.0 / SCIO™ 8.0 12

© PLATO AG 2019

The display in the form sheet AIAG/VDA D-FMEA looks as follows:

The blocking function (system response) is indicated with the addition “Blocked by:” underneath the

failure.

Into the new form sheet AIAG/VDA D-FMEA percentage values for the probable coverage of monitoring and

system response can be entered (see also figure “Failure net”). BC stands for „Best coverage“ (Monitoring)

and BE for „Best effectiveness“ (Response).

5 e1ns.aspects

5.1 Turning connections into functions

Connections between aspects can now be created as functions for system elements. The blocks, however,

must be part of the BOM (Bill of Material) for the menu item Create function from connection to be

activated.

The name of the newly created function is put together as follows:

Port type – Name of the connection – Direction (Input / Output) – Name of the system element

Procedure:

• Select a connection.

• Choose Create function from connection in the context menu.

For the system element that is left by the connection (Charger), the following function is created:

ELECTRICAL – VOLTAGE (5 V) - OUTPUT – BATTERY

For the system element to which the connection points (Battery), the following function is created:

ELECTRICAL – VOLTAGE (5 V) – INPUT – CHARGER

In addition, messages are shown in the lower right display area.

• Open a form sheet.

The functions are listed at the end of the column “Function” with the generated name.

Deleting functions in system elements does not affect the display in e1ns.aspects. The connections

will remain in it.

When creating a bidirectional connection, the functions input and output are both created underneath the

every system element.

If a function name already exists, no function will be created. A corresponding error message will be shown

in the lower right display area.

By means of the PLATO plug in technology the default behavior for Create function from connection can be

adapted to specific customer needs. Please approach your PLATO contact person.

7.5.1 Methodical enhancement – ASIL Decomposition

The method for Functional Safety now contains the following method form sheets:

• Item Definition

• Hazard Analysis

• ASIL Decomposition

• FMEDA (26262)

The new form sheet for an ASIL decomposition is used for a method to reduce the original ASIL

classification of a component. This method can be carried out when the component requirements can be

spread among several independent components. The decomposition rules of ISO 26262 are applied.

11.2.3 Importing user data

The user administration now allows importing new users as well as updating or deactivating already

existing users. Before the eventual import takes place, the expected import results will only be displayed. In

a verification step the user can see what the expected result will look like and either decide not to carry out

the import or edit the import data again.

Only a user with administrator rights [1] can carry out the import.

Procedure and preparations:

Take notice of the following points before starting the import!

• Allowed import formats: CSV (semicolon [;] as separator) and Excel (.xlsx)

Page 30: PLATO e1ns 3.0 / SCIO™ 8 · 2019. 8. 7. · • PFMEA AIAG/VDA The structure analysis (higher level, focus element, lower level) is displayed in the head area. The form sheet shows

PLATO e1ns 3.0 / SCIO™ 8.0 29

© PLATO AG 2019

• Notes on import templates: A CSV or Excel import template can be chosen in the selection menu

Options/Downloads. The files already contain the column headings and two exemplary users. The

password column is not included and needs to be added, if necessary.

• Expected characters / character encoding: The input data is expected to be encoded in UTF-8. It

means that “everything” can be entered but must be delivered to the import with the corresponding

character encoding.

An Excel import file is expected to have the workbook format. The name of the workbook has to

contain the name “e1ns-User-Import”. A prefix or suffix can be appended to the name (e. g. a date).

• Column names: The column names are predefined and must not be changed.

• Status values: The status values Inactive, Active, Invisible, and System are predefined. NOTE: Users

with the status “System” are currently skipped and will not be processed during an import.

• Required and optional column names, respectively:

Column names Required Optional

User name ✓

First name ✓

Last name ✓

Telephone ✓

Email ✓

External ID ✓

SSO ID ✓

Department ✓

Status ✓

Rights classes ✓

Password ✓ (when SSO is not used)

• Notes on optional fields: In order to prevent updating and overwriting of existing user data in

optional fields, the fields’ values can be defined to exclusively contain an asterisk symbol [*].

• Note on enumerating rights classes: Enumerations of rights classes in the field “Rights classes” must

be separated by a comma [,].

• Note on the column “User name”: The column “User name” must always be completed with a

unique name.

• Determination of key fields: Depending on the configuration made in the Application.ini, one of the

fields “User name”, “External ID” or “SSO ID” will be used as key field during the import. This

determination allows to uniquely identify existing users during the import process and to determine

whether the import data contains new users or users that ought to be updated.

Detailed information on configuration can be obtained from your PLATO contact person.

11.6 Java component was replaced

Until now, the PLATO Software has used the Java component of Oracle for internal processes. This

component was recently replaced to avoid license fees for Java in the long-term run. Java was replaced by

the component OpenJDK 11.
